Abstract
This paper presents a neural network controller scheme for boost converters. This controller is designed to stabilize the output voltage of the boost converter and to improve its performance during transient operations. To investigate the effectiveness of the proposed controller, certain operations such as starting up and reference voltage variations are verified. The simulation results show that the proposed controller has an improved performance compared to the conventional PI controller method.
